Azerbaijani Units Use Striking Drones
Azerbaijani units opened fire on March 25 at night on the positions of the Artsakh Defense Army, utilizing both various calibers of small arms and striking drones. On March 24, units of the Azerbaijani Armed Forces violated the requirements of the trilateral statement of November 10, 2020, by invading the Republic of Artsakh's territory under the responsibility of the Russian peacekeeping forces, seizing control of the village of Parukh in the Askeran region and adjacent positions. They then attempted to advance in the eastern border zone of the Republic of Artsakh, reported the Defense Army.
“Hours of negotiations between the Russian peacekeeping forces and the relevant authorities of Artsakh did not yield significant results, and the adversary did not return to their initial positions. As a result of the exchange of fire, at least 5 servicemen from the adversary side were killed, while there is one wounded on the Armenian side. As of 09:00, the situation is relatively stable. We expect that Russian peacekeepers will take measures to return Azerbaijani units to their initial positions,” the Defense Army stated.
